autologous

adj

Etymology

From autology + -ous.

Definitions

  1. Derived from part of the same individual (i.e. from the recipient rather than a different…

    Derived from part of the same individual (i.e. from the recipient rather than a different donor).

    • When she relapsed with metastatic breast cancer after exhausting all conventional therapies, her doctors suggested an autologous bone marrow transplant as a last resort.
